Take a look at this beautiful 10.75 acre estate parcel in a rural setting surrounded by field, forest and conservation land! Located just off Rte. 136 in New Boston only 15 minutes to Crotched Mtn. skiing and golf, and just 35 minutes to Manchester or Concord. This parcel is Lot 3 of only 3 available in this subdivision, surrounded by fields, forest and established homesteads. This is the largest of the 3 lots available and has 640' of frontage along the conservation land that can also be purchased. This lot and the 2 others slope up from the road to provide a terrific setting looking West across the valley and the Piscataquog River watershed. Conservation land beside and in front of the property assures no further homes to obstruct the peaceful setting. The conservation land consists of 75 acres of open and wooded land suitable for agricultural purposes used primarily for hay and with an existing structure on it, and is not listed for sale but available to purchase. This parcel is in Current Use, and the fee shall be paid by the Buyer when the town assesses it (they have 15 months to levy the assessment), unless you purchase the abutting conservation land in which case most of this parcel can remain in Current Use.
